Three days ago, I came across a post shared by a former executive at AIA Vietnam. His name is L?u K? Nam. In his beautiful post, he asked others what the keywords in 2022 they will bring to 2023. I asked him what was his and “stay open” to keep experiment different things was the answer. At first, I picked my word to bring to 2023 is curiosity. However, my decision changed on that evening.?

That night, we practice picking new initiatives & priorities for 2023 together as family. It was a wonderful exercise and we decided rather to bring what was from 2022 to 2023, it is better to create something new in the new year so all of us can learn something completely new. Does it mean curiosity is not important? No. We just want 2023 to be a different year. The Greek philosopher Epicurus once said: “Nothing is enough for the man to whom enough is too little.” So, our word of the new year is “less”. While many of us want more things to happen in our life, let’s practice something in the opposite direction and see how it will change our world.

Here are some examples of creating “less”:

  • Spending less on things we don’t need so we can give more.
  • Thinking less of ourselves and more for others.
  • Wasting less time on things that holding us from growing.
  • Meeting people that drain out our energy less.
  • Involving with drama less. Reducing noises.
  • Participating with activities outside of home less so we can have more time for those who are inside circle of love.
  • Having less people in our circle of influence so we can have more time to help them think, learn, and grow.
  • Meeting online less so we can have more face-to-face conversations.
  • Saying less Yes to things that we really don’t want to do.
  • Doubting our capabilities less and believing more on what we can become. Stopping it is hard but learning to having less of this kind of thinking is doable.
  • Feeling bad for the mistakes that we’ve been making over the years less. No one is perfect.
  • Letting our thought leading our feelings less. Learn how to take the driver seat instead.
  • Planning less but doing more.
  • Following orders from others less so we can be more independent and more creative.
  • Talking less so we can listen more.
  • Comparing less so we can appreciate and be grateful more.

The list goes on. For anything that we less focusing on, there will be other and better things we can work on. What we choose to focus on will grow. Our question for you: “What are the things you will do less in 2023?
